The ceremony is expected to be a serious business on Saturday at the Union Buildings in Pretoria when President-elect Jacob Zuma is sworn in.

But it will also be party time as an impressive line-up of artists has been put together.

The selected artists reflect the young and the old, traditional and new, young hip sounds, meaning that everyone's taste will be catered for.

Hector Sibongiseni Mthokozisi Langa will be the event's imbongi and other artists include the Johannesburg Philharmonic Orchestra, Soweto Gospel Choir, Southern Lawns for the public, Nothembi Mkhwebane, Mfolosha Nkwe with Thabeng-Dinaka tsa Bapedi, Setapa Setswana Dance Mosekaphofu, Mkhonto Dancers, Navara - Indian Dancers, Khoisan Dance and music by Ixhange group, Tu Nokwe, Karen Zoid, The Parlotones and Jozi.

Other artists are Sello Galane, Gang of Instrumentals and DJ Oskido.
